The Longevity Meme reaches top 100 Folding@home teams
December 18th, 2008 by Ben ScarlatoThe Longevity Meme recently made it into the top 100 Folding@home teams. The Longevity Meme offers prizes to its top contributors so if you haven't already you should download the software, which you can run while your computer is idle and join the Longevity Meme team. Folding@home is over 4 petaflops of distributed computing that contributes to some really cool research on protein folding.
